Transaction 3c15c371a78974eaf0115b972ad96b74a58a3bbb29f0f8a948c9a4fde899696c
1 Input
1 Output
-
3c15c371a78974eaf0115b972ad96b74a58a3bbb29f0f8a948c9a4fde899696c:0
- value
- 4999345
- script pubkey
- OP_0 OP_PUSHBYTES_20 41cdf5e043862affddf298652775d71c66e11e02
- address
- bc1qg8xltczrsc40lh0jnpjjwawhr3nwz8szzxth9w